17:08 < Stelz> List of Linux colormanaged applications
17:09 < Stelz> what about inkscape?
17:09 < trb7> i was reading some info on that
17:09 < trb7> it supports lcms, but
17:09 < trb7> they don't mention how do you specify the ICC profile
17:09 < trb7> in their wiki, they mention SVG 1.2
17:09 < trb7> and the capability to embed the ICC profile in a tag
17:09 < trb7> at the beginning of the SVG file
17:09 < trb7> it seem this is work in progress
17:09 < Stelz> ah.. i see
17:10 < trb7> in any case, it builds with the new location for lcms, argyll, etc... (/opt/color)
17:10 < trb7> same for scribus
17:10 < trb7> works perfectly
17:10 < trb7> gimp 2.2 is another story, color management was pooched in 2.2
17:10 < trb7> altough it has preliminary ICC support
17:10 < trb7> it behaves very very badly
17:10 < Stelz> CMS available from version 2.3 and on.
17:10 < trb7> so they decided to shift that to 2.4
17:11 < trb7> yes exactly
17:11 < Stelz> hm.. gimp 2.4 is coming soon?
17:11 < trb7> the preliminary support is in 2.2 however, but it behaves so badly that i decided to pass --without-lcms
17:11 < trb7> to avoid the crashes if you try to load an ICC profile
17:11 < trb7> and this is a gimp related issue, not lcms or related to the lcms or icc profiles location
17:11 < trb7> gimp 2.4, i have no idea, but 2.3.12 already has 3 google's SoC projects in cvs
17:12 < trb7> and a 4th, SVG support for vector layers, was so big, that they made a cvs tree just for it
17:12 < trb7> for post-2.4
17:12 < trb7> but healing brush, perspective cloning, are already in 2.3.12
17:12 < trb7> and ruby-fu should be out soon, as well as full jpeg2000
